>To my knowledge, it is not possible to do it, since XX-7 command
>station transmits only midi clock and Cubase is not able to be synced
>using Midi clock(not accurate enough I guess)...
>There may be some workaround but I haven't found it.
>(for instance I tried to 'convert' Midi clock to Midi Time Code using
>Midi OX but it didn't work. Well I didn't try that hard either, so
>there may be some hope...)
